Calculate the patient's intake in mL based on the information provided. Intake: 10 oz of orange juice 1 bowl of oatmeal 8 oz of coffee with 3 teaspoons of creamer 1 piece of toast 6 oz of gelatin?

Answer :

Final answer:

To calculate the patient's intake in mL, convert the given measurements to milliliters and add them up.

Explanation:

To calculate the patient's intake in mL, we need to convert the given measurements to milliliters. 1 oz is equal to 30 mL, so 10 oz of orange juice is equal to 300 mL. 1 bowl of oatmeal and 1 piece of toast do not have a specific measurement provided, so we cannot calculate their intake in mL. 8 oz of coffee with 3 teaspoons of creamer is equal to 240 mL of coffee plus the volume of the creamer. Lastly, 6 oz of gelatin is equal to 180 mL. Add up all the converted measurements to get the total intake in mL.
